Appearance

The Cyclamen Success? Rose plant has heart-shaped leaves that are green with silver markings. The flowers bloom on tall stems and can be pink or white, with petals that curl back at the tips. The plant can grow up to 8 inches tall and 10 inches wide. Cyclamen Success? Rose blooms from fall to spring and can produce flowers for several months if cared for properly.

Care Guide

Water: Cyclamen Success? Rose prefers moist soil, but be careful not to overwater as this can cause root rot. Allow the soil to dry out slightly between waterings.

Fertilization: Feed Cyclamen Success? Rose with a balanced fertilizer every two weeks during the growing season.

Soil: Cyclamen Success? Rose prefers well-draining soil that is rich in organic matter.

Sunlight: Cyclamen Success? Rose prefers bright, indirect light and can be grown indoors near a window or outdoors in a shaded area.

Hardiness Zones: Cyclamen Success? Rose is hardy in zones 5-9.

Common Pests & Diseases

Cyclamen Success? Rose is susceptible to pests such as spider mites, thrips, and aphids. It can also be affected by diseases such as powdery mildew and root rot. To prevent these issues, keep the plant in a well-ventilated area, avoid overwatering, and inspect the plant regularly for signs of pests or disease.
